National Pump Company (NPC) offers a comprehensive line of API 610 vertical turbine pumps designed for the rigorous requirements of the oil and gas industries.

The pumps are engineered to meet the requirements of the current edition of API 610 standards.

This allows NPC’s vertical turbine designed pumps to provide the reliability, hydraulic performance and maintainability required in critical service applications such as tank farms, pipeline booster stations, refineries and terminals.

NPC provides VS0 submersible, VS1 sump, and VS6 canned vertical turbine configurations. These pumps feature robust, vertically suspended bowl assemblies with precision-cast, hydraulically balanced impellers.

This design delivers high efficiency across a broad operating range while minimizing vibration and wear.

Heavy wall column pipe precision machined, flanged and registered column connections maintain precise shaft alignment, which translates into smoother operation, longer mechanical seal and bearing life, and reduced overall maintenance costs for end users. A rigid, API compliant fabricated discharge head provides stable support for the pump and driver to help ensure dependable performance.

The vertical turbine configuration allows installation in sumps, cans, or below-grade tanks, minimizing above-ground footprint and simplifying piping layouts, which is advantageous in space-constrained environments.

Multiple nozzle orientations and suction arrangements are available within API 610 guidelines. To handle the high axial thrust loads, typical in deep-set and high-head services, NPC incorporates API 610-type thrust bearings and shaft designs sized for long life at design load.
